Summary:
The CSIRO David Irvine Postgraduate Scholarship supports PhD and MPhil students pursuing cybersecurity research at selected Australian CSCRC partner universities. It offers generous annual stipends up to AUD $46,000, plus training allowances and access to world-class research environments. Applicants must hold First Class Honours (or equivalent), be enrolled full-time in an eligible program, and already have a tuition fee waiver from the university. The scholarship focuses on advanced cybersecurity research themes like threat detection, authentication, and IoT security. Applications close 16 February 2026, and international applicants must already be residing in Australia with the correct visa.
